Watched one of the best sports movies ever that no one really talks about The Set Up. The movie is from the 40s and the story is about a boxer (Stoker) who's long past his prime, boxing against an up and coming kid. Stoker believes he's just one punch away from returning to the top, problem is no one believes him. His manager arranges with a gangster for him to lose by knockout in the 3rd round but doesn't even bother to tell Stoker about it because he believes he has no chance of winning. His wife is tired of watching him get his brain bashed it and wants him to quit for good. This film blew me away it was excellent, a very good dramatic film about the passage of time and fate about a boxer with one more chance at glory. Martin Scorsese showed the cast of The Aviator this film before shooting.
